Abstract

Semicarpus Anacardium Linn is one of the most prominent, effective, and widely used herbs for natural treatments. Semicarpus anacardium contains a variety of flavonoids, including jeediflavanone, semicarpuflavanone, galluflavanone, nallla flavanone, semarcarpetin, and bilawanol in the fruit, as well as amentoflavone and quercetin in the leaves. The internal administration of juice by quakes may result in accidental poisoning. The juice is introduced in the vagina as a punishment for infidelity. Bilawanol is extracted from fresh fruits collected from the farm of Semicarpus anacardium using an ultrasonic assisted technique. Extracted alkaloids are identified by different methods such as colour tests, thin layer chromatography, and infrared spectroscopy techniques used for forensic analysis.
